Job summary
The Bladder and Bowel Service is a dynamic and developing facility where an enthusiastic team of specialist nurses provide education, advice, support and clinical care for patients across and health and social care settings within Nottingham City.
We are looking for an experienced, passionate, motivated and conscientious person to join this established team of nurses and administrators.
The hours of work will be 37.5 hours over 5 days (Monday Friday 8.30am - 4.30pm excluding weekends and bank holidays).

Main duties of the job
You will be working to support the Bladder and Bowel Specialist nurses with comprehensive administrative tasks and be a main point of contact and coordination for the clinicians and patients using the service; an excellent telephone manner is essential. In addition, you will have responsibility for coordinating prescriptions for continence products and arranging appointments for patients.
You will need to demonstrate excellent interpersonal and communication skills. This is a busy service, and you must be able to prioritise tasks and manage time effectively; you must also be able to work flexibly within the team ensuring cover during the service hours. Experience of using Systm One would be beneficial.
Confidence in managing own workload in a timely and effective way, whilst dealing with patients / carers in a caring and professional manner is essential.

Job description
Job responsibilities
Job Purpose
- To provide clerical/ administrative support for the day-to-day administration for continence service within Adult Services.
- Work effectively as part of a busy administration team.
Dimensions
- Ensure team are aware of own role and any latest information for cover arrangements or support.
- To actively participate in CityCare mandatory training and team specific training.
Key Responsibilities
- To provide full clerical/ administrative support to the Bladder and Bowel Specialist Serviceon a day-to-day basis,
- To have a good working knowledge and experience of Microsoft Office in particular Microsoft Word to produce letters and other word-processed documents to a high standard and knowledge of Microsoft Access and Excel for developing in house databases / spreadsheets and Outlook for diary management / e-mails,
- To have accurate keyboard skills and diligence when using SystmOne,
- To be responsible for answering and fielding telephone calls appropriately from a wide variety of sources where there may be barriers to understanding. To record telephone messages in writing and act promptly if urgent responses are needed,
- To accurately collate and input data and produce statistics as and when required
- To maintain diaries, make appointments, arrange meetings etc. as and when required
- To take minutes/ notes of meetings as and when required, including preparation and distribution of agenda and minutes,
- To undertake general office procedures including photocopying, filing and the distribution of mail,
- To implement and update office systems/procedures as required, in collaboration with the team,
- To provide full administration support for the recruitment process being the vital link between Team Managers, Candidates and HR,
- To work effectively as part of a team to provide cover for other administration staff when required and to be flexible regarding working hours to meet the needs of the service,
- To accurately record and maintain systems for staff sickness, absence, and annual leave,
- To order stock and non-stock equipment via the on-line systems and to maintain stock levels of stationary
- To be client-driven on behalf of the service and ensure that the reception people are given is welcoming and helpful,
- To maintain strict confidentiality in all aspects of work in line with policies and the Data Protection Act,
- To plan / organise work using own initiative within set departmental parameters,
- To undertake any additional duties as appropriate and delegated by the Admin Team Manager and deputy and Service Team Managers.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
